I suck at writing rock/pop/punk that’s fast and upbeat, how can I improve?? by sillyyfishyy in Songwriting

[–]Internal_Olive1185 4 points5 points  (0 children)

I used to be stuck in ballad mode. Forcing myself to write lots of three chord songs helped as simpler songs lend themselves to up tempo. Also if you’re current songs have lots of chords writing songs in 12/8 can be a handy trick. As I find that time signature lends itself to that.
